Frank Hildebrand

Frank Ray Hildebrand, 83, of Lafayette, died Wed.-June 10, 2015 at 4:20pm at his residence, after a 9-week battle with cancer. He was born June 18, 1931 in Delphi, to the late Martin & Clara Faye Weaver Hildebrand. His marriage was to Phyllis Jean Hill in Delphi at the Methodist Church, on Nov. 26, 1953, and she survives. He was a 1949 graduate of Delphi High School, and attended IUPUI in Kokomo. He worked for Eli Lilly & Co., from 1958 until his retirement in 1985, a senior personnel rep for the last 20 years. He was a Korean War Veteran, serving in the U.S. Army. He was extremely active and a member of the Christ United Methodist Church in Lafayette. He was a member of the Delphi American Legion Post #75, and the Lafayette Indiana Historical Auto Club. On Sept. 29, 2014 he went on the Honor Flight to Washington, D.C. He and his wife enjoyed traveling, and wintering in Daytona Beach, FL for many years. He enjoyed genealogy, and was an avid reader.
